Auburn Interagency Calendar
 
The Auburn Interagency Calendar is compiled by Auburn City Council to inform local community service providers about the support networks and interagencies available to them in the Auburn area.
 
The calendar includes a description, dates, contact and venue information for each interagency.

Interagencies and networks in Auburn

There are 18 regular interagencies and networks held in the Auburn local government area covering a range of community issues and service areas.
 
These include:
  • Auburn Artists Network (AAN)
  • Auburn Children’s Services Network (CSN)
  • Auburn Community Drug Action Team (CDAT)
  • Auburn Employment Working Group (EWG)
  • Auburn Holroyd Child Protection Interagency (CPI)
  • Auburn Housing Working Group (HWG)
  • Auburn Interagency (AI)
  • Auburn Multicultural Interagency (AMI)
  • Auburn Small Community Organisation Network (ASCON)
  • Auburn Youth Advisory Collective (AYAC)
  • Auburn Youth Interagency (AYI)
  • Auburn/Holroyd/Parramatta HACC Forum
  • Refugee Youth Interagency Network (RYI)
  • Stop Domestic Violence Action Group (SDVAG)
A number of interagencies and committees have limited membership.
 
These include:

  • Auburn ClubGRANTS Local Committee
  • Auburn Community Access Committee
  • Community Consultative Commitee 
  • Auburn Somali Community capacity Building Project Steering Committee
